harusamei / zebura

a framework for querying data using natural language
BSD 2-Clause "Simplified" License
0 stars 0 forks source link

查询结果输出哪些信息 #20

Open harusamei opened 4 months ago

harusamei commented 4 months ago

列出除用户原始query和原始db查询结果外,还需要在界面上展示什么信息

  1. NL2SQL结果是否展示
  2. 如果NL2SQL失败,系统显示用户query缺少必要的DB信息时,展示什么? 是否给一些可能的QUERY hint, 比如你是否想查询XXX, 这个可以列出 golden cases中找到的top 3
  3. 如果DB查询结果为空,输出什么
  4. 如果查询结果太多,输出什么
  5. 啥时候展示 表, 啥时候展示图
  6. 系统出错时展示什么, 如LLM链接不出, 查DB出错等各种错误